Berklee College of Music

Boston, MA berklee.edu 7,510 students

Berklee College of Music is situated in the heart of Boston, offering students access to a vibrant urban environment. The college is renowned for its focus on contemporary music, including jazz, rock, hip hop, and other modern genres. Berklee's curriculum emphasizes practical training and performance, preparing students for careers in the music industry. The college also operates a campus in Valencia, Spain, providing international opportunities for its students.

Financial Aid

The sticker price is rarely what families actually pay. Berklee College of Music's grant and scholarship aid lowers the net price for most income brackets. 15% of students receive Pell Grants; 33% take federal loans.

Key Insight

Average net price across income brackets is $46,197, roughly 8% lower than the published tuition.

Net Price by Family Income

Academic Year 2025
Income Bracket Avg Net Price 4-Year Net Cost
$0 – $30K $38,537 $154,148
$30K – $48K $39,205 $156,820
$48K – $75K $46,723 $186,892
$75K – $110K $50,150 $200,600
$110K+ $56,371 $225,484
Sticker price (no aid) $50,270 $201,080
Net price = tuition + fees + room & board minus grants and scholarships, by reported family-income bracket. Source: IPEDS Student Financial Aid survey via College Scorecard.
